Yatra Online, Inc. announced its financial results for the three months and the fiscal year ended March 31, 2025. The company reported a revenue of INR 2,192.5 million (USD 25.7 million) for the three months ended March 31, 2025, marking a 114.0% year-over-year increase. This growth was primarily driven by the expansion of the MICE business and contributions from the recent acquisition of Globe Travels. For the fiscal year 2025, Yatra Online reported a total revenue of INR 7,957.3 million (USD 93.1 million). The results from operations for the year showed a loss of INR 89.9 million (USD 1.1 million), which is an improvement from the previous year's loss of INR 158.8 million (USD 1.9 million). The adjusted EBITDA for the year was INR 343.8 million (USD 4.0 million), reflecting a 28.3% increase year-over-year. In terms of business segments, the adjusted margin from air ticketing decreased by 23.5% year-over-year to INR 925.8 million (USD 10.8 million), while the adjusted margin from hotels and packages increased by 23.3% to INR 357.8 million (USD 4.2 million). The total gross bookings, including air ticketing, hotels and packages, and other services, amounted to INR 18,713.9 million (USD 219.1 million), experiencing a 6.3% decrease year-over-year. The company did not provide specific future outlook or guidance in the released results.
